Transaction 40eccde8dbd84d23ca12a4febdd629bc98dd9b861722d69ca411d19516b71444

2 Input
1 Outputs
  • 40eccde8dbd84d23ca12a4febdd629bc98dd9b861722d69ca411d19516b71444:0
  • value  114357
    address  15kPJkFgQkjpzrBRePC5H5iP7mvpV4DByh